53. The menu developers for a chain of coffee shops have conducted experiments to see how long customer take to make a drink choice, based on the number of drinks on the menu. Normalizing so that th average time needed to make a choice given just two drinks is 1 time unit. the average times needed to make a choice given n drinks on the menu are shown in the table below. Number of choices, 2 3 4 5 6 7 average time to make a choice 1 1.4 1.7 2 2.2 2.3 (a) (5 points) Use regression to find a function that models the data. Round the values of the coeffi- cients to the nearest thousandth. (b) (3 points) Using your model, predict the average time to make a choice if there are 10 drinks on the menu. ​
